How Czechs Are Booking Luxury Beach Trips Early-By Plane and in Style

June 21, 2026 Lucas Fernandez – World Editor World

As of June 21, 2026, Czech travelers are increasingly prioritizing luxury, early booking, and air travel for their summer vacations. This shift toward high-end tourism reflects a broader European trend of resilient consumer spending despite inflationary pressures, forcing travel firms to adapt to more demanding, high-budget client expectations in competitive Mediterranean markets.

The Evolution of the Czech Tourism Market

The contemporary Czech tourist is no longer merely looking for affordability; they are actively seeking convenience and premium experiences. According to recent data from Seznam Zprávy, there is a marked increase in the purchase of travel packages months in advance, often bypassing traditional road trips in favor of air travel. This shift suggests a significant change in the disposable income allocation of Central European households.

While the European travel sector faced stagnation in previous years, the current surge in bookings for 2026 demonstrates a recovery in consumer confidence. However, this trend creates logistical bottlenecks for regional operators. As demand for luxury air travel peaks, firms are struggling to manage supply chain disruptions in aviation fuel and airport ground handling services.

Global economic observers note that this behavior mirrors the “revenge travel” phenomenon seen post-pandemic, but with a more permanent shift toward quality over quantity. Macro-Economic Implications of Premium Tourism

The rise in high-end travel spending is not an isolated event; it is a signal of shifting capital flow within the European Union. As Czech citizens direct more capital toward international tourism, foreign direct investment (FDI) in Mediterranean hospitality sectors—specifically in Greece, Croatia, and Spain—has intensified. This trend is closely monitored by the World Bank, which tracks how tourism-dependent economies manage the influx of foreign currency.

However, the reliance on air travel for these luxury trips exposes travelers and firms to volatile fuel prices and geopolitical instability. “The volatility in global energy markets continues to act as a hidden tax on the tourism sector,” notes Dr. Elena Rossi, a senior economist at the European Center for Economic Policy. “When consumers prioritize luxury, they become hypersensitive to service quality, yet the underlying operational costs remain vulnerable to global supply shocks.”

Corporations servicing this market must account for these risks. Without robust hedging strategies and legal frameworks, travel agencies face significant exposure to sudden cost spikes. Infrastructure Strains and the Demand for Efficiency

The shift toward booking months in advance is, in part, a reaction to the instability of the 2024-2025 travel seasons, where last-minute cancellations were frequent. By locking in travel dates early, Czech tourists are attempting to mitigate the risk of price surges. This, however, places extreme pressure on reservation systems and hotel inventory management.

Geopolitical Shifts in Tourism Destinations

The choice of destination is also evolving. While traditional hubs remain popular, there is a growing interest in emerging markets that offer exclusivity. This geographic diversification is changing the diplomatic landscape as well. Countries that successfully cater to the high-spending Czech demographic are finding themselves with increased political leverage within the European bloc, using tourism revenue to offset trade deficits in other areas.

The intersection of leisure and geopolitics is profound. As states compete for the “luxury tourist” dollar, they are easing visa requirements and investing in prestige infrastructure projects. This creates a feedback loop: better infrastructure attracts more investment, which in turn draws a wealthier class of traveler.
